## v5.3.0 (2022-03-04)
|
|
|
|
* Add `with_port_of_string` function (@dinosaure, @hannesm, #108)
|
|
* **breaking-change** Be restrictive on `Ipaddr.of_string` (@dinosaure, @hannesm, #109)
|
|
Before this release, `Ipaddr.of_string` accepts remaining bytes and returns
|
|
a valid value such as `"127.0.0.1aaaa"` is valid. Now, `ipaddr` does not
|
|
accept a string with remaining bytes.

## v5.0.0 (2020-06-16)
|
|
|
|
* Do not zero out the non-prefix-length part of the address in
|
|
`{V4,V6}.Prefix.t` (#99 @hannesm)
|
|
Removed `{V4,V6}.Prefix.of_address_string{,_exn}` and
|
|
`{V4,V6}.Prefix.to_address_{string.buffer}`
|
|
|
|
To port code:
|
|
- if you rely on `Prefix.of_string` to zero out the non-prefix-length address
|
|
bits, call `Prefix.prefix : t -> t` subsequently.
|
|
- `Prefix.of_address_string{,_exn}` can be replaced by
|
|
`Prefix.of_string{,_exn}`, to retrieve the address use
|
|
`Prefix.address : t -> addr`.
|
|
- The `Prefix.to_address_{string,buffer}` can be replaced by
|
|
`Prefix.to_{string,buffer}`, where `Prefix.t` already contains the IP
|
|
address to be printed.
|
|
- Instead of passing `{V4,V6}.t * {V4,V6}.Prefix.t` for an
|
|
address and subnet configuration, `{V4,V6}.Prefix.t` is sufficient.

## v4.0.0 (2019-07-12)
|
|
|
|
* Rename the `to/from_bytes` functions to refer to `octets`
|
|
instead. This distinguishes the meaning of human-readable
|
|
addresses (`string`s in this library) and byte-packed
|
|
representations(`octet`s in this library) from the OCaml
|
|
`bytes` type that represents mutable strings.
|
|
|
|
Porting code should just be a matter of renaming functions
|
|
such as:
|
|
- `Ipaddr.of_bytes` becomes `Ipaddr.of_octets`
|
|
- `Macaddr.to_bytes` becomes `Macaddr.to_octets`

## 3.0.0 (2019-01-02)
|
|
|
|
This release features several backwards incompatible changes,
|
|
but ones that should increase the portability and robustness
|
|
of the library.
|
|
|
|
* Remove the sexp serialisers from the main interface in favour
|
|
of `pp` functions. Use the `Ipaddr_sexp` module if you still
|
|
need a sexp serialiser.
|
|
|
|
To use these with ppx-based derivers, simply replace the
|
|
reference to the `Ipaddr` type definition with `Ipaddr_sexp`.
|
|
That will import the sexp-conversion functions, and the actual
|
|
type definitions are simply aliases to the corresponding type
|
|
within `Ipaddr`. For example, you might do:
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
type t = {
|
|
ip: Ipaddr_sexp.t;
|
|
mac: Macaddr_sexp.t;
|
|
} [@@deriving sexp]
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
The actual types of the records will be aliases to the main
|
|
library types, and there will be two new functions available
|
|
as converters. The signature after ppx has run will be:
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
type t = {
|
|
ip: Ipaddr.t;
|
|
mac: Macaddr.t;
|
|
}
|
|
val sexp_of_t : t -> Sexplib0.t
|
|
val t_of_sexp : Sexplib0.t -> t
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
* Break out the `Macaddr` module into a separate opam package so
|
|
that the `Ipaddr` module can be wrapped. Use the `macaddr`
|
|
opam library now if you need just the MAC address functionality.
|
|
|
|
* Replace all the `of_string/bytes` functions that formerly returned
|
|
option types with the `Rresult` result types instead. This stops
|
|
the cause of the exception from being swallowed, and the error
|
|
message in the new functions can be displayed usefully.
|
|
|
|
* In the `Ipaddr.V6.to_string` and `to_buffer` functions, remove the
|
|
optional labelled argument `v4` and always output v4-mapped strings
|
|
as recommended by RFC5952. (#80 by @hannesm).
